Where and in what way did Lenin expect WWI to start, based on his theory about capitalism?

a. Out of competition over control of the Mediterranean and near-Atlantic shipping lanes
b. On the borders of Germany as neighboring states attempted to take Germany's industrial resources by force
c. Out of imperialist conflicts on the colonial peripheries
d. Within capitalist states as the proletariat began to revolt against the oppression of capitalist machinery
e. Between Russia and capitalist states as Russia attempted to spread communist philosophy


Answer: c
